This simple and delicious recipe for oven-roasted asparagus is the perfect addition to your favorite meal. Oven-roasting is an easy way to add a new spin on any veggie. Tip: when roasting, the thicker the asparagus the better — thin asparagus may be tough and stringy.

Serves 4
Calories: 40
Total fat: 2 g
Saturated fat: 0 g
Trans fat: 0 g
Cholesterol: 0 mg
Sodium: 290 mg
Total carbohydrate: 5 g
Dietary fiber: 2 g
Sugar: 2 g
Protein: 3 g
